Weather Situation
A vigorous westerly airstream will ease tonight as a cold front clears eastern Victoria. A high pressure ridge will extend over northern Victoria on Sunday before a cold front crosses southern Victoria on Monday. The high pressure ridge will then extend across northern Victoria on Tuesday before a weak cold front crosses southern Victoria on Wednesday.
